abstract="<p>Patients admitted to hospital because of infections have a 42% increased risk of death by suicide, a study published in JAMA Psychiatry has found.  Infection and inflammation have increasingly been linked with a potential critical role in psychiatric disorders and suicidal behaviour, so the researchers attempted to estimate the association between admission for infection and the risk of death by suicide. They used data from Danish longitudinal registers on 7.22 million people aged over 15 living in Denmark …</p> <p>Language: en</p>",
